2. Security Mechanisms
Security mechanisms are integral to the operation of a two-post automobile elevate. These options are designed to mitigate dangers related to lifting heavy masses, defending each personnel and gear. The absence or malfunction of those mechanisms can have extreme penalties, resulting in gear failure, automobile injury, and potential accidents. A typical instance is the inclusion of locking arms. These arms interact at predetermined intervals throughout the elevate’s ascent, mechanically stopping the elevate from decreasing unintentionally. If a hydraulic line had been to rupture, these locking arms would arrest the descent, stopping a catastrophic failure. The presence and correct functioning of those options are subsequently important for secure operation.
Past locking arms, different security mechanisms embrace strain aid valves inside the hydraulic system. These valves stop over-pressurization, which might injury the hydraulic elements or trigger sudden, uncontrolled actions of the elevate. Common inspection and upkeep of those valves are essential. Moreover, some lifts incorporate automated shut-off methods that activate if the elevate encounters an obstruction throughout ascent or descent. The sensible utility of understanding these mechanisms lies in proactive upkeep and diligent pre-operation checks. Technicians needs to be skilled to determine indicators of damage, injury, or malfunction in these security elements, making certain that any points are addressed promptly.

3. Set up Requirements
Set up requirements for two-post automobile lifts dictate the precise procedures and standards for his or her secure and efficient setup. These requirements, typically mandated by regulatory our bodies and producers, deal with important facets akin to flooring load capability, anchoring necessities, and electrical connections. Adherence to those requirements is paramount as a result of improper set up can compromise the structural integrity of the elevate, resulting in gear malfunction, automobile injury, or, in probably the most extreme instances, severe harm or demise. For instance, if a elevate is put in on a concrete slab that doesn’t meet the minimal thickness or power necessities, the anchors might fail underneath load, inflicting the elevate to break down. Strict adherence to set up requirements serves as a major protection in opposition to such failures.
The sensible utility of those requirements extends past the preliminary setup. Common inspections ought to embrace verification that the elevate stays correctly anchored and that the encircling flooring exhibits no indicators of cracking or degradation. Documentation of the set up course of, together with load calculations and anchor specs, is important for future upkeep and troubleshooting. Furthermore, certified and licensed technicians ought to carry out installations and subsequent inspections, making certain that every one procedures are adopted appropriately and that any deviations from the requirements are recognized and addressed promptly. Failure to adjust to these practices can invalidate warranties and improve legal responsibility within the occasion of an accident.

6. Structural Integrity
Structural integrity, within the context of a two-post automobile elevate, refers back to the capacity of the elevate’s elements to face up to utilized masses and stresses with out failure or vital deformation. This capability is key to the secure and dependable operation of the gear, defending each personnel and autos from potential hurt.
-
Materials Composition and High quality
The supplies used within the development of a two-post lifttypically high-strength steelmust possess particular properties to withstand bending, shearing, and tensile forces. The standard of the supplies, together with their grade and manufacturing course of, immediately impacts their capacity to face up to these stresses. Decrease-quality supplies could exhibit untimely fatigue or cracking, compromising the elevate’s total power. An instance could be the usage of licensed metal versus non-certified metal which dramatically impacts the load-bearing functionality.
-
Welding and Fabrication Methods
The strategies used to affix the assorted elements of the elevate, akin to welding, play a important function in sustaining structural integrity. Faulty welds, characterised by porosity, incomplete fusion, or improper bead geometry, can considerably weaken the construction and create stress focus factors. Correct weld inspection and high quality management are important to making sure the structural soundness of the elevate. An instance of this may be robotic welding versus guide welding that improves the welds high quality.
-
Design and Engineering Specs
The design and engineering of a two-post elevate should account for all anticipated masses and stresses, incorporating security elements to accommodate variations in automobile weight and operational circumstances. Finite aspect evaluation (FEA) and different simulation strategies are sometimes used to optimize the design and determine potential weak factors. Deviations from the unique design specs, akin to alterations to the elevate arm dimensions or column bracing, can negatively influence its structural integrity. Licensed engineers design will guarantee most power.
-
Corrosion Prevention and Safety
Publicity to environmental elements, akin to moisture, chemical substances, and salt, can result in corrosion of the elevate’s metal elements, lowering their power and rising the chance of failure. Protecting coatings, akin to paint or powder coating, are generally utilized to mitigate corrosion. Common inspection and upkeep of those coatings are obligatory to make sure their effectiveness. Moreover, indoor storage and correct cleansing practices may also help reduce the chance of corrosion.

Query 1: What are the first security concerns when working a two-post elevate?
Protected operation mandates adherence to the producer’s tips, together with correct automobile positioning, weight limitations, and pre-operation inspections of security mechanisms akin to locking arms and hydraulic methods. Formal coaching can also be required to make sure security.
Query 2: How does flooring thickness influence the set up of a two-post elevate?
Flooring thickness is important as a result of it determines the anchoring power of the elevate. Insufficient flooring thickness can compromise the elevate’s stability, rising the chance of collapse. Seek the advice of the producer’s specs for minimal flooring thickness necessities.
Query 3: What’s the advisable frequency for inspecting a two-post elevate?
Common inspections ought to happen earlier than every use and at the very least month-to-month. A complete annual inspection by a certified technician can also be advisable to determine potential points that is probably not obvious throughout routine checks.
Query 4: What kind of upkeep is important for two-post lifts?
Important upkeep contains lubrication of transferring components, inspection of hydraulic traces and fittings, verification of locking mechanisms, and checking for indicators of corrosion or structural injury. An in depth upkeep log is essential for monitoring accomplished duties.
Query 5: How can the lifting capability of a two-post elevate be precisely decided?
The lifting capability is specified by the producer and indicated on the elevate’s information plate. It is essential to by no means exceed this score and to confirm the automobile’s weight earlier than lifting. Account for any added weight of auto modifications and if the weights are unsure, take the automobile to a weigh station to make sure for security.
Query 6: What are the symptoms of potential structural failure in a two-post elevate?
Warning indicators embrace uncommon noises throughout operation, seen cracks or deformation within the elevate’s construction, extreme play in transferring components, and hydraulic fluid leaks. Any of those indicators warrant fast cessation of operation and inspection by a certified technician.

Important Ideas for Two-Publish Car Carry Operation
The next tips are essential for maximizing the lifespan and making certain the secure operation of two-post automobile lifts. Adherence to those suggestions minimizes the chance of accidents and gear failure.
Tip 1: Conduct Pre-Operational Inspections. Prior to every use, completely examine all important elements, together with elevate arms, locking mechanisms, hydraulic hoses, and security latches. Any indicators of damage, injury, or malfunction should be addressed instantly.
Tip 2: Adhere to Weight Capability Limits. By no means exceed the producer’s specified weight capability. Precisely decide the automobile’s weight earlier than lifting, accounting for any aftermarket modifications or added equipment. Overloading poses a major security threat.
Tip 3: Guarantee Correct Car Positioning. Rigorously place the automobile on the elevate arms, making certain that the burden is evenly distributed and that the middle of gravity is correctly aligned. Incorrect positioning can result in instability and potential tip-over.
Tip 4: Have interaction Locking Mechanisms. At all times interact the elevate’s locking mechanisms on the desired working top. These mechanisms present a secondary security measure within the occasion of hydraulic failure.
Tip 5: Keep a Clear and Organized Workspace. Maintain the world surrounding the elevate away from obstructions, instruments, and particles. A cluttered workspace will increase the chance of slips, journeys, and falls.
Tip 6: Implement a Preventative Upkeep Schedule. Comply with the producer’s advisable upkeep schedule, together with lubrication of transferring components, inspection of hydraulic fluid ranges, and substitute of worn elements. Common upkeep extends the elevate’s lifespan and minimizes the chance of sudden breakdowns.
Tip 7: Present Complete Operator Coaching. Be sure that all personnel working the elevate have obtained thorough coaching on its correct use, security procedures, and emergency protocols. Retraining needs to be performed periodically to strengthen finest practices.
